The Concept of 'Sugar Blockers'

For many years, the idea of a 'sugar blocker' has captivated people hoping for a simple solution to weight management and blood sugar control. The term broadly refers to anything that inhibits the body's ability to digest or absorb carbohydrates and sugars. However, the reality is far more complex than a single pill or magic bullet. The methods for controlling sugar absorption range from natural compounds and dietary fibers to prescribed medications for managing diabetes. Understanding the different approaches is crucial for making informed health decisions.

Natural Supplements that Act as 'Sugar Blockers'

Several natural compounds and extracts have gained popularity for their purported sugar-blocking properties. These often work by inhibiting digestive enzymes or altering the body's response to sugar. It is important to note that the efficacy and safety of these supplements can vary, and they should be discussed with a healthcare provider, especially for those with existing health conditions.

Here are some common examples:

  • Berberine: A bioactive compound found in several plants, berberine is known for its ability to activate AMPK, a metabolic master switch that regulates glucose and lipid metabolism. It can inhibit an enzyme in the gut that breaks down dietary sugars, potentially reducing the amount of sugar absorbed.
  • Gymnema Sylvestre: This herb has been used in Ayurvedic medicine for centuries as a treatment for diabetes. Studies suggest it can reduce sugar absorption in the intestines and suppress the sweet taste receptors on the tongue, which may help curb sugar cravings.
  • L-arabinose: Derived from plant material, L-arabinose works by inhibiting the sucrase enzyme, which is responsible for breaking down sucrose (table sugar) in the small intestine. This effectively 'blocks' the digestion of sucrose, leading to its incomplete absorption.

Pharmaceutical Options for Blocking Sugar

In clinical settings, specific prescription medications are used to help manage blood sugar by blocking absorption or excretion. These are primarily for individuals with type 2 diabetes and are regulated by health authorities.

  • Alpha-Glucosidase Inhibitors: Medications like acarbose and miglitol work by blocking the alpha-glucosidase enzyme in the intestine, which breaks down starches into glucose. This slows down carbohydrate digestion and absorption, preventing a sharp rise in blood sugar after a meal.
  • SGLT2 Inhibitors: Sodium-glucose cotransporter 2 (SGLT2) inhibitors, such as dapagliflozin, empagliflozin, and canagliflozin, block the SGLT2 transporter in the kidneys. This prevents the reabsorption of glucose from the urine back into the bloodstream, causing excess sugar to be excreted. This class of medication is not a 'blocker' in the digestive sense but effectively lowers overall blood sugar levels.

Dietary and Lifestyle Alternatives to Sugar Blockers

For those seeking to manage sugar intake without supplements or medication, several dietary and lifestyle strategies can effectively regulate blood sugar and reduce absorption naturally.

Incorporating More Fiber

Dietary fiber plays a critical role in moderating blood sugar levels. Soluble fiber, in particular, slows down the digestion and absorption of carbohydrates, leading to a more gradual increase in blood sugar. Foods rich in soluble fiber include oats, beans, peas, apples, and citrus fruits.

Pairing Carbohydrates with Protein and Healthy Fats

Consuming carbohydrates alongside protein or healthy fats can help slow down digestion and stabilize blood sugar levels. This is because protein and fat take longer to digest, moderating the speed at which sugar enters the bloodstream. A handful of nuts with a piece of fruit or adding a protein source to a meal can be a simple, effective strategy.

The Role of Exercise

Physical activity is a powerful tool for blood sugar management. Exercise helps your muscles use blood glucose for energy, increasing insulin sensitivity. Even short bursts of exercise, like a 15-minute walk after a meal, can significantly improve blood sugar control.

Conclusion: Separating the Hype from the Science

So, is there a sugar blocker? The answer is not a simple 'yes' or 'no.' While the concept of a magical pill is largely a myth, there are scientifically supported methods—both natural and pharmaceutical—that can effectively help manage sugar absorption and blood sugar levels. For those with type 2 diabetes, prescription medications are the most potent and reliable option, but require medical supervision. For the general population looking to improve their health and manage sugar intake, focusing on dietary fiber, intelligent food pairing, and regular exercise offers safe and sustainable results. Supplements can play a role, but their effectiveness is less consistent, and they should be used with caution and professional guidance. Ultimately, managing sugar is a holistic process that involves more than just 'blocking' it; it's about adopting healthy habits that promote overall well-being.
